Corner Cottage, dating back to the 18th Century, provides excellent well planned family accommodation with three reception rooms, four bedrooms, double garage and workshop. Range of domestic buildings and grounds extending to 0.3 acre or thereabouts.

The property, originally thought to be two cottages (there are two existing staircases) incorporates early stone base coursing in parts of the structure. Central heating is gas fired with panelled radiators and most windows are replacement uPVC double glazed units. A double garage and workshop were constructed just over twenty years ago and an extensive range of outbuildings, contemporary with the age of the cottage, are also of brick and pantile construction. The accommodation is well planned and practical for a modern family lifestyle. The property is conveniently situated and the village is only 3 miles from Newark and 5 miles from Southwell.

The accommodation comprises, on the ground floor, porch entrance, sitting room, conservatory, inner lobby, living room, dining room, 21' kitchen, utility room and pantry. The first floor provides a galleried landing, four bedrooms, master ensuite, bathroom and separate WC.

Averham, a small relatively unspoilt village with the Minster town of Southwell 5 miles to the south, and the thriving market town of Newark 3 miles to the east, is ideally located for schools and amenities. Southwell schooling is of renowned standards across the age ranges. The market town of Newark offers an extensive range of retail amenities, professional services, restaurants and leisure facilities including a sports centre and marina. From Newark there is direct access to the A1 national road network and fast direct rail links to London King's Cross with journey times just over 75 minutes. The City of Nottingham is approximately 20 miles and there is a direct rail service from Newark Castle station to Nottingham and Lincoln. Perhaps as just conveniently, commuters can catch a train from Fiskerton station direct to Nottingham city centre. The popular Fox Inn at Kelham is just under a mile away. The famous Robin Hood Theatre is located close to St Mary's Church in the village. Unusually Averham 'little theatre' has, in the past, hosted professional productions and enjoys great support from the wider locality.
